cgroup: fix idr leak for the first cgroup root
The valid cgroup hierarchy ID range includes 0, so we can't filter for
positive numbers when freeing it, or it'll leak the first ID. No big
deal, just disruptive when reading the code.
The ID is freed during error handling and when the reference count hits
zero, so the double-free test is not necessary; remove it.
